Technical Specifications
The SA604AD/01,118 operates within the industrial temperature range and comes in a compact SO8 package. It integrates several stages of the FM IF strip, including a limiter amplifier, quadrature discriminator, and RSSI (Received Signal Strength Indicator) circuitry. The advanced design ensures excellent intermodulation rejection and low cross-modulation, which are crucial for consistent performance in the presence of adjacent channel interference.
